About a year ago I made a few orders with them, and everything seemed of great/expected quality.

They are a bit pricier than average I think, but chalk up a 5 star review from me

There are cheaper ways to assemble a rebuild kit, but sometimes it's nice just to have everything clearly packaged together.

I bought my headers from them last year and it fits and runs great. Nice precision cuts due to CNC machines compared to the one it replaced which looked like it was cut with a jig saw then filed (but not bad for a 22 year old header I bought from Northwest Offroad Specialties back in 1993).
